Peugeot E-208 GTi makes a grand debut at Le Mans

KUALA LUMPUR: After a five-year hiatus, Peugeot has brought back its famous GTI badge to the world of Le Mans racing. This time, it’s for the electric E-208, making it the most powerful and high-performing hot hatch in the electric market.

KEY TAKEAWAYS

  • What is the legacy of the Peugeot GTi badge?

    The GTi badge dates back to 1984 with the iconic 205 GTi. Over the years, it has been worn by performance icons like the 205 GTi, 306 GTi, 206 GTi, 207 GTi, and 208 GTi.
  • What makes the Peugeot E-208 GTi special?

    The Peugeot E-208 GTi is the brand’s first-ever 100% electric GTi, which combines racing excellence with modern driving pleasure.
  • The Peugeot E-208 GTi, inspired by the iconic 205 GTi and created by Peugeot Sport, showcases a dramatic overhaul of the city-focused electric car. It is specially tuned by the same team behind the powerful 9X8 hypercar.

    Peugeot E-208 GTi: Key highlights 

    Exceptional performance 

    Powering the E-208 GTi is an M4+ electric motor that kicks out a maximum power of 280 hp and a peak torque of 345 Nm. It offers the best performance of all models in the B segment with a 0-100 kmph acceleration time of 5.7 seconds and a top speed of 180 kmph.

    Adding to the performance is a limited-slip differential integrated into the reducer that optimises cornering behaviour, and offers agility, efficiency, and stability.

    The e-motor is paired with a CATL-sourced 54 kWh nickel-manganese-cobalt battery pack optimised for sporty use. It delivers a range of 350 km (on the WLTP cycle) between charges and can be charged from 20-80% in less than 30 minutes when using a 100kW DC connection.

    Bolder stance

    With the GTi DNA at its heart, the E-208 GTi marks a distinction with its bolder stance, courtesy of a body lowered by 30 mm and tracks widened by 56 mm at the front and 27 mm at the rear. Contributing to the appearance are the large 18-inch wheels with "PEUGEOT GTi" badges, which pay homage to the iconic "Hole" wheels of the 205 GTi.

    Peugeot has also widened the wheel arches to accommodate the increased tracks and highlighted with an elegant and sporty red line.

    Striking exterior design

    Dipped in a bright red body colour, the new Peugeot E-208 GTi benefits from a string of exclusive visual touches, including 

    • A front spoiler
    • A bigger and more pronounced rear wing
    • A specific aerodynamic rear diffuser, integrating a new small LED fog light
    • Peugeot’s signature three-claw LED headlights with three separate LED modules 
    • Red accents across the vehicle, adding a touch of excitement
    • Lots of sporty GTI badges

    Immersive and inspiring cabin

    Peugeot E-208 GTi cabin Photo from Peugeot

    The iconic red colour also adds dynamism and energy to the vehicle’s cabin. There are bright red carpets, floor mats, and seatbelts, as well as the new front seats with integrated headrests, paying tribute to the 205 GTi. The compact steering wheel features perforated red leather combined with Alcantara and a red central emblem. 

    The Peugeot E-208 GTi offers an immersive cockpit experience with digital display and central screen featuring sporty red graphics, special performance screens, red ambient lighting and a custom sound experience (can be turned on or off).

    High-performance chassis

    The new E-208 GTi features the best power-to-weight ratio in its segment (5.7 kg/hp) thanks to the numerous modifications made to the chassis by Peugeot Sport engineers.

    The lowered body and widened tracks are combined with springs and shock absorbers with specific hydraulic stops, Michelin Pilot Sport Cup 2 tyres, and a rear anti-roll bar. The ESP system comes with a specific Sport mode that suspends driver assistance systems to maximise driving sensations.

    High-performance braking

    As for braking, the new E-208 GTi is equipped with 355 mm front discs with 4-piston fixed callipers and red-painted callipers, ensuring optimal and constant braking power in all circumstances. The rear disc brakes are the same as the standard e-208.

    Alain Favey, CEO of PEUGEOT, said, “We are thrilled to introduce the new PEUGEOT E-208 GTi, a ground-breaking next chapter in an iconic GTi story. This model represents a fusion of our rich heritage with cutting-edge technology, offering unparalleled performance and driving sensations, because at PEUGEOT, we are serious about driving pleasure. With this new GTi, we set new standards within the hot hatch market.”
